Subject: Cut-over summary — GPU memory profiler

For the security review: we've cut the Kestrelworks fleet over from the legacy Vramline profiler to the new Hexport tooling. Hexport samples GPU allocations in-process but exports only aggregated histograms — no raw pointers or tensor contents leave the host. Export traffic rides the existing mTLS mesh, and the collector runs unprivileged. Retention on the aggregation store is seven days. The profiler's deployed configuration values are listed below.

config for haweg-bagag:
[kasath]
host = kasath.qirvancorp.internal
user = kasath_svc
database = kasath_prod

As discussed for the weekly eng sync: the thumbnail generation queue is configured entirely through the environment. `THUMB_QUEUE_CONCURRENCY` controls worker parallelism (default 4), `THUMB_MAX_DIMENSION` caps output size, and `THUMB_RETRY_LIMIT` bounds reprocessing attempts. Please be careful with concurrency on shared staging nodes, since the resizer is memory-hungry. The queue worker also authenticates to the broker before pulling jobs, and it reads that credential from the line immediately following this one in the env file.

env line for fafof-fahag: LEDGER_TOKEN5=f8790

## Password Reset Revamp — Orindale Auth

The revamped flow replaces emailed tokens with short-lived signed codes stored in the auth_resets table. Rate limiting lives in middleware, not the handler. Old tokens are honored until the cleanup migration runs. To inspect reset records locally, connect to the development database using the connection string below.

primary connection of tajeg-tajop = postgresql://julax_svc:DI@db-e7f3.kelvidyn.corp:5432/rusdor